We are a community-led registered charity set up to bring the derelict bandstand site in Queen’s Park, Glasgow, back to life as a flexible Arena and to run it, in agreement with Glasgow City Council. The Arena offers the local community opportunities for music, dance, drama, festivals, filming, sport and other activities. These activities are now administered through Inhouse Ltd.
